Covid-19: Test confirm 14 positive cases at Genoa

Second round of testing has confirmed the 14 positive cases of coronavirus at Genoa, who await Serie A’s decision on the match against Torino.


The Rossoblu have confirmed the second round of swabs confirmed the 14 positive tests over the weekend.


This morning, the other members of the team and staff arrived by car at the training ground and were swabbed from the vehicle before returning home.


The employees and executives who were tested yesterday have all received negative results for COVID-19.


Genoa are waiting for the League’s decision on the scheduled match against Torino on Saturday.
